The short version

Kiowa has notably lower household income than the US average, with a median household income of $31,141. Population has declined 9% since 1990. Median home value is $27,900. With a median age of 45.4, the population is older than the US median of 35.2.

Frequently asked

How many people live in Kiowa, Kansas?

Kiowa, Kansas has about 1,055 residents according to the 2000 Census.

What is the median household income in Kiowa, Kansas?

The typical household in Kiowa, Kansas earns about $31,141 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.

Is Kiowa, Kansas expensive?

In Kiowa, Kansas, the median home is worth about $27,900, and the typical rent is about $345 a month.

How educated are people in Kiowa, Kansas?

About 24.9% of adults age 25 and over in Kiowa, Kansas h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

What is the poverty rate in Kiowa, Kansas?

About 14.2% of people in Kiowa, Kansas live below the federal poverty line.
